  1. The Scottish Avalanche Information Service has started reporting again
    for the Northern Cairngorms and Lochaber. Other areas will start
    reporting December 21.

    http://www.sais.gov.uk/

    The reports contain info on snow and ice conditions and a brief weather
    forecast as well as avalanche warnings.

    There is snow in the Cairngorms at present, down to 300 metres.
